In city design projects exactly where open trench excavation is disruptive or impractical, trenchless systems have grown to be ever more essential. Pipe jacking is a person these kinds of process that enables pipelines to generally be mounted underground devoid of considerable surface area disruption. This method includes pushing prefabricated pipe sections in the ground applying hydraulic jacks from a start shaft to your receiving shaft. Pipe jacking is particularly practical beneath occupied roadways, railways, or present infrastructure, in which protecting floor operations is crucial.
